The very first hours: evaluation that actually notifies care
No 2 detoxes look the same. A 28-year-old with weekend binges shows up with various risks than a 62-year-old drinking a fifth of vodka daily. On admission, clinicians take a complete medical and use history, then connect that info to unbiased scoring. You can expect questions about what, just how much, and when you drink, previous withdrawal experiences, other compounds, sleep, diet plan, present medications, and psychological health symptoms. Important signs, labs, and a physical exam follow. Heart rate, high blood pressure, oxygen saturation, and temperature level use early cautions that the central nervous system is under tension. Standard laboratories frequently include a thorough metabolic panel, magnesium, phosphate, complete blood count, liver function, and sometimes an ECG, especially for those with chest discomfort, palpitations, or electrolyte imbalance.
One tool appears consistently: the Scientific Institute Withdrawal Evaluation for Alcohol, Modified. The CIWA-Ar score guides dosing during detox from alcohol by score symptoms such as queasiness, trembling, anxiety, agitation, sweats, sensory disturbances, headache, and orientation. Scores typically organize into moderate, moderate, and severe categories. Treatment at Turning Point of Tampa utilizes these ratings in context, not in seclusion. For example, a moderate score with a blood pressure spike may trigger an earlier medication dose than a rating alone would suggest.
This early evaluation also screens for warnings that move the detox plan. A history of seizures or delirium tremens, day-to-day high-volume drinking, severe liver illness, active infection, pregnancy, or unrestrained psychiatric signs can alter medication options and keeping an eye on frequency. Precise info at this stage reduces complications later.
What detox seems like day by day
People request a sensible image due to the fact that the unidentified feeds stress and anxiety. While your course might vary, there is a recognizable rhythm to the alcohol detox process.
The first 6 to 12 hours after the last drink often feel uneasy instead of significant. Stress and anxiety, light trembling, queasiness, and bad sleep creep in. Hydration and food sometimes seem difficult. By 12 to 48 hours, signs peak. Trembling ends up being more noticable, the pulse accelerates, and blood pressure climbs up. Sweats, shakiness, nausea, and irritability control, and sleep can break down into short, unsatisfying stretches. Hallucinations can occur without confusion, usually visual or tactile. The risk window for seizures sits mainly between 6 and 48 hours, with the greatest concern around the very first day. Between 48 and 72 hours, many people improve meaningfully, especially with sufficient medication. Appetite returns, queasiness alleviates, and tremor softens.
A smaller group establishes delirium tremens around days 3 to 5, marked by confusion, severe autonomic instability, agitation, and vivid hallucinations. This is a medical emergency. With early recognition and the right setting, results are great. The point of structured care is to detect this change before it accelerates.
By day 4 or 5, sleep and state of mind start to normalize, though lots of report remaining anxiety and tiredness. Intense detox usually runs 3 to 7 days. After that, post-acute signs can flicker for weeks: poor concentration, vibrant dreams, mood swings. Planning for those weeks matters as much as handling the very first 3 days.
Medication choices and why they differ
The medications used at Turning Point of Tampa alcohol detox are familiar in evidence-based alcohol withdrawal care, but the way they are dosed and combined reflects each patient's threat profile.
Benzodiazepines remain the workhorse for moderate to serious withdrawal. Choices like diazepam, lorazepam, and chlordiazepoxide are selected based upon liver function, age, and sign profile. A patient with cirrhosis and raised ammonia endures lorazepam much better since it relies less on hepatic metabolism. Somebody younger with intact liver function may gain from diazepam's longer half-life, which smooths symptom rebound. Dosing can follow a symptom-triggered plan tied to CIWA-Ar scores or utilize a set taper for those with a history of severe withdrawal or unreliable reporting. Symptom-triggered dosing generally suggests less overall medications, but repaired dosing is safer in particular high-risk scenarios.
Adjuncts can complete care. Gabapentin sometimes assists with stress and anxiety, sleep, and neuropathic discomfort and can lower the total benzodiazepine problem. Clonidine or propranolol might be used to blunt tachycardia and high blood pressure, though they do not deal with the underlying withdrawal. Antipsychotics are utilized sparingly and only for severe agitation or hallucinations, always together with a primary withdrawal representative. For severe cases or when benzodiazepines underperform, phenobarbital can be considered in a controlled setting by clinicians knowledgeable about its narrow therapeutic window.
Equally crucial are nutrients. Thiamine avoids Wernicke's encephalopathy, a brain injury linked to alcohol-related thiamine exhaustion. Thiamine needs to be given before high-carbohydrate fluids or meals, and typically at greater doses initially, then tapered. Folate and a multivitamin assistance wider deficiencies. Magnesium replacement is common, assisted by labs.
This mix is dynamic. Medications increase if your hands shake and your blood pressure spikes, then taper down as your body settles. The goal is comfort without oversedation and protection without needless polypharmacy.
Comfort care that pays dividends
People notification the small, physical information during detox more than any policy. Simple procedures help. Hydration is structured instead of optional. Oral rehydration solutions are encouraged early. For those who can not keep fluids down, antiemetics buy time. Light, frequent meals are more reasonable than a heavy plate 3 times a day. Think broth, yogurt, bananas, toast, eggs, and rice.
Sleep is challenging in early withdrawal. Rather of chasing after perfect sleep with heavy sedatives, the method focuses on sleep health and stable sign control. Dim light, temperature control, and foreseeable nighttime checks lower sleep fragmentation. Brief naps are encouraged over midafternoon marathons that postpone a regular nighttime cycle. Mild extending, assisted breathing, and short, low-stimulus walks are readily available as soon as essential indications stabilize. These interventions are not fluff. They shorten the viewed length of detox and enhance desire to transition into the next stage of care.
Medical monitoring and when escalation is needed
Monitoring is routine and clear. Crucial indications are examined routinely initially, then less typically as stability returns. CIWA-Ar scoring begins on a set schedule, with extra look for any change in psychological status or grievances of visual disruption. Blood sugar tracking is added for diabetics or those with bad nutrition. Oxygen saturation and cardiac rhythm get attention in older grownups and those with recognized heart disease.

Escalation requirements are spelled out so no one needs to guess. A sudden dive in heart rate or blood pressure that does not respond to an additional dose, new confusion, a very first seizure, or consistent throwing up are all triggers for a higher level of care or transfer. Family members sometimes fear that escalation equates to failure. It does not. It means the group is choosing security. The majority of clients total detox at the very same level of care they started, however having a clear path for complications prevents doubt when minutes matter.

Medication for alcohol use condition is talked about early, once intense withdrawal settles. Naltrexone, acamprosate, and disulfiram each fit various profiles. Naltrexone decreases benefit after drinking and can reduce cravings. Acamprosate supports early abstaining in those with comprehensive withdrawal histories. Disulfiram is an option for a small subset who value responsibility and are not likely to consume impulsively. Addressing special situations
Not everybody fits the book. Older adults metabolize medication in a different way and may have underlying cognitive disability that withdrawal can imitate or worsen. For them, lower starting doses, slower tapers, and closer neurological checks prevent oversedation and confusion. Individuals with liver disease gain from lorazepam-based procedures, cautious fluid management, and earlier involvement of hepatology when indicated. Those with co-occurring stimulant or opioid use need integrated preparing so that benzodiazepines do not communicate with unreported substances, therefore that opioid use disorder medications can be started seamlessly.
Pregnancy requires obstetric cooperation. Detox can be done safely with adjusted medication options and fetal tracking. Waiting till after delivery is not constantly much safer. Clear communication with all dealing with teams minimizes danger and stress.

Common misconceptions and what experience shows
A couple of persistent myths can thwart good choices. The very first myth is that white-knuckling it in the house builds strength. In fact, without treatment moderate to extreme withdrawal taxes the heart and brain and raises regression danger quickly after signs peak. Another misconception claims that tapering alcohol yourself is more secure than a medical detox. Self-tapers generally undervalue consumption or lose track under tension. A structured alcohol detox plan uses medications that are exact, supervised, and easier to cease. A 3rd misconception suggests that if you did not seize the last time you stopped, you are safe this time. Risk collects with age, disease, and drinking patterns. A fourth misconception states that benzodiazepines used in detox develop dependency. Short, clinically supervised courses do not create a brand-new dependence in this context, and they prevent serious complications.
Experience likewise overturns the idea that detox need to be unpleasant. With today's finest alcohol detox methods and modern protocols, the majority of people report pain, not misery, and an unexpected sense of relief by day three.
